Silent Witness Series 29 Announces Birmingham Relocation and February Premiere
Silent Witness Moves to Birmingham for Series 29

The BBC has officially announced the highly anticipated return of its long-standing forensic drama, Silent Witness, with series 29 set to premiere in early February 2026. This new instalment marks a significant milestone for the show, as it undergoes a major geographical shift, relocating its setting from London to Birmingham for the first time in its history.

A New Forensic Hub in Birmingham

Series 29 will see the team establish their operations at The Sir William Bowman Centre of Excellence, based at Birmingham General Hospital. This move follows the cliffhanger conclusion of series 28, where Dr Nikki Alexander, portrayed by Emilia Fox, was tasked with setting up this new forensic centre. The relocation plot point introduces fresh dynamics and challenges for the characters, particularly impacting Harriet, played by Maggie Steed, whose professional future was left uncertain.

Returning Cast and Narrative Continuity

Fans will be delighted to welcome back key cast members, including Emilia Fox as Dr Nikki Alexander and David Caves as Jack Hodgson. They are joined once again by Maggie Steed as Harriet and Francesca Mills as Kit. The series will continue directly from where the previous season ended, exploring the aftermath of Nikki and Jack's wedding and the implications of their move to the West Midlands.

Star-Studded Guest Appearances and Episode Details

The new series promises to deliver compelling storytelling with five distinct narratives spread across ten episodes. Viewers can expect appearances from a host of notable guest stars, such as Lydia Wilson, Chris Reilly, Ben Batt, Vinette Robinson, Selin Kizli, and Gerard Kearns. Additional talent includes Adam Rayner, Phaldut Sharma, Dino Fetscher, Cat Simmons, Chris Coghill, and Mollie Winnard, ensuring a diverse and engaging cast lineup.

Broadcast Schedule and Fan Reactions

Episodes will air weekly on BBC One and be available on BBC iPlayer every Monday and Tuesday night, commencing on Monday, February 2, 2026.
